The Allure of Modern Architectural Styles

Modern architectural styles consistently captivate homeowners seeking a sleek, functional, and aesthetically pleasing living environment. These styles, often characterized by clean lines, minimalist ornamentation, and an emphasis on natural light, offer a refreshing departure from more traditional designs. The core principles of modern architecture focus on open floor plans, seamless integration of indoor and outdoor spaces, and the use of innovative materials such as steel, glass, and concrete. This creates a sense of spaciousness and connectivity, making homes feel both inviting and sophisticated. The enduring appeal of modernism lies in its ability to adapt to various contexts while maintaining a timeless elegance.

The Impact of Natural Light and Open Spaces

A defining feature of modern design is the intentional incorporation of natural light. Large windows, skylights, and strategically placed openings maximize daylight penetration, reducing reliance on artificial lighting and fostering a connection with the surrounding environment. This not only enhances the aesthetic appeal of a space but also contributes to improved mood and well-being. Coupled with open floor plans, natural light creates a sense of airiness and flow, making even smaller spaces feel larger and more inviting. The seamless transition between interior and exterior spaces further accentuates this effect, blurring the boundaries between home and nature.

Architectural Style
Key Characteristics
Mid-Century Modern Clean lines, organic shapes, use of natural materials, emphasis on functionality.
Minimalism Extreme simplicity, neutral colors, uncluttered spaces, focus on essential elements.
Contemporary Evolving style, reflects current trends, often incorporates sustainable materials and technology.
Brutalism Raw concrete, geometric forms, monumental scale, emphasis on structural expression.

Interior Design Trends: Embracing Texture and Color

Beyond the architectural framework, interior design plays a crucial role in establishing the personality and atmosphere of a home. Current trends are shifting away from stark minimalism towards a more layered and textured approach. Warm, earthy tones are gaining popularity, replacing the cool grays that dominated in recent years. The incorporation of natural materials such as wood, stone, and woven textiles adds depth and visual interest, creating a sense of warmth and comfort. This trend reflects a growing desire for spaces that feel inviting, grounded, and connected to nature. The aim is to create interiors that nurture the senses and promote a sense of well-being.

The Role of Textiles and Sustainable Materials

Textiles play a vital role in layering texture and adding visual interest to interior spaces. From plush rugs and cozy throws to patterned cushions and elegant drapery, fabrics can transform a room’s atmosphere. Sustainable materials are increasingly favored, with options like organic cotton, linen, and recycled fibers gaining prominence. This reflects a growing environmental consciousness among homeowners, who prioritize ethical and responsible choices. Furthermore, the use of vintage and antique pieces adds character and a sense of history to a space, creating a unique and personalized aesthetic.

  • Incorporate natural fiber rugs for warmth and texture.
  • Utilize sustainable fabrics like organic cotton or linen for upholstery.
  • Layer cushions and throws in varying textures and colors.
  • Introduce vintage or antique pieces for character and history.

This conscientious approach toward materials elevates the design without compromising principles of sustainability, a philosophy gaining traction throughout the design world. Choosing pieces with a story and selecting ethically sourced materials adds an additional layer of depth and meaning to any living space.

The Rise of Smart Home Technology

Smart home technology is rapidly transforming the way we interact with our living spaces. From automated lighting and temperature control to integrated security systems and voice-activated assistants, these innovations offer convenience, energy efficiency, and enhanced security. Smart thermostats learn your preferences and adjust heating and cooling accordingly, saving energy and reducing utility bills. Smart lighting systems allow you to control illumination remotely, creating customized ambiance and enhancing security. Integrated security systems provide peace of mind, monitoring your home and alerting you to any potential threats. The integration of these technologies elevates the homeowner experience, making life simpler, more comfortable, and more secure.

Integrating Technology Seamlessly into Your Home

The key to successful smart home integration is seamlessness. The technology should enhance your lifestyle without being intrusive or complicated to use. Choosing a unified platform and ensuring compatibility between different devices is crucial. Professional installation can also ensure that the system is set up correctly and functions optimally. Consider your specific needs and priorities when selecting smart home technologies. For example, if energy efficiency is a top concern, invest in smart thermostats and lighting controls. If security is paramount, prioritize a robust security system with remote monitoring capabilities. Building a smart home that caters to your needs allows for a more comfortable and connected lifestyle.

  1. Assess your needs and priorities.
  2. Choose a unified smart home platform.
  3. Ensure compatibility between devices.
  4. Consider professional installation for optimal setup.

The benefits of a well-integrated smart home system are considerable, offering improved comfort, enhanced security, and reduced energy consumption. As technology continues to evolve, smart homes will become even more intuitive and personalized, further enhancing the homeowner experience.

Creating Functional and Stylish Kitchens

The kitchen remains the heart of the home, and its design significantly influences both functionality and aesthetic appeal. Modern kitchen designs prioritize open layouts, ample storage, and streamlined functionality. Island kitchens are particularly popular, providing extra counter space, seating, and storage. High-quality appliances, durable countertops, and stylish cabinetry are essential components of a well-designed kitchen. Lighting plays a crucial role, with a combination of task lighting, ambient lighting, and accent lighting creating a warm and inviting atmosphere. The objective is to create a space that is both practical for cooking and entertaining and aesthetically pleasing to the eye.

Efficient organization within the kitchen is also incredibly important, impacting the daily flow of activity. Thoughtful design choices, like pull-out shelving, pantry organization systems, and designated zones for specific tasks, can dramatically improve functionality. This emphasis on intelligent storage solutions transforms the kitchen into a space that's not only beautiful but also exceptionally efficient.

Beyond Aesthetics: Sustainable Living and Home Design

An increasing number of homeowners are prioritizing sustainable living and incorporating eco-friendly practices into their home design. This includes choosing energy-efficient appliances, utilizing renewable energy sources, and adopting water conservation measures. Sustainable materials, such as reclaimed wood, bamboo, and recycled content, are gaining popularity. Passive solar design, which maximizes natural heating and cooling, can significantly reduce energy consumption. Landscaping with native plants requires less water and maintenance, promoting biodiversity.
